Matthew Ch 9 vv 1-13

                Matthew was a man with power too, but along with that he suffered the dislike of his fellow Jews for he was not much better than a collaborator with the occupying Romans. Just as Jesus could read what was in the hearts of the lawyers (v 4), so He could see into the heart of this tax collector and knew how much Matthew needed to be healed in spirit if not in body and just how great was his need of real purpose in life. Matthew’s dinner-party was a declaration of his new life. Jesus incurred the wrath of the Pharisees yet again by attending. They would not for a moment count themselves among the sick or the sinners, but in fact their condition was much more serious. Are we aware of our own spiritual condition? Pray for the discernment to know how you are and the wisdom to know where to go for the healing we all need.
